About the Cost of Living in Phoenixville
The median home value in Phoenixville is $348,200 — 14% above the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$1,563/month, 19% higher than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$94,411/year is 27% higher than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 3.8%, below the national average of 4.8%. Pennsylvania's top state income tax rate is 3.1% and the combined sales tax is 6.3%. The climate averages highs of 61.3°F and lows of 42.5°F. Overall, Phoenixville has a cost of living index of 116 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 16% more expensive.

🌤 Climate
NOAA 1991–2020 Climate Normals
| Month |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| High °F | 37 | 40 | 49 | 61 | 71 | 79 | 84 | 82 | 75 | 63 | 52 | 42 |
| Low °F | 22 | 23 | 30 | 40 | 50 | 59 | 64 | 62 | 55 | 43 | 34 | 27 |
| Precip" | 3.02 | 2.56 | 4.07 | 3.64 | 3.69 | 3.84 | 4.72 | 4.38 | 4.83 | 3.81 | 3.02 | 3.76 |
